Ahmad Bradshaw might be out for a while for the New York Giants
The Giants will be without running back Ahmad Bradshaw for at least tomorrow’s game with a ankle injury and maybe longer. He has played in 10 games for the Giants this season and he has carried the ball 115 times for 549 yards (4.8 ypc) with 4 TD runs. Bradshaw has also caught 10 passes for 96 yards (9.6 avg) so far this season. 24-year old Danny Ware will take over Bradshaw’s role in the offense until he is ready to return to action. Ware has played in 5 games this season and he has 4 carries for 24 yards (6.0 ypc). The Giants will miss Bradshaw but it will be interesting to see how well Ware plays as he has a lot of potential.
